Zachary L'Heureux
Zachary L'Heureux is a Canadian ice hockey forward who plays for the Halifax Mooseheads of the QMJHL. He was drafted by the Nashville Predators in the first round of the 2021 NHL Entry Draft with the 27th overall pick in the draft.[1] According to L'Heureux, he models his playing style after agitators such as Brad Marchand and Matthew Tkachuk.[2] On July 28, 2021, L'Heureux signed his entry level deal with the Predators.[3]
